City Administrator Tom Swenson presented a letter from the Army Corps of Engineers to the Crosslake City Council at the regular monthly meeting on June 8. The letter stated that the ACOE would continue to regulate the Headwaters of the Mississippi under the current operating regulations through the 2009 summer recreation season.

Bomb found at gas station in Bock
A bomb was found behind TNT Gas Station in Bock Sunday, June 14 around 3 p.m. Residents and businesses were evacuated within a three block radius while the bomb disposal unit from Crow Wing County arrived and diffused the bomb.

Fiflty Lakes Boy Upgraded to Fair Condition After Fall
A Fifty Lakes boy was critically injured Thursday during a fall at his home. According to the Crow Wing County Sheriff's Department, five-year old Tristan Veit was airlifted by North AirCare to North Memorial Medical Center in Robbinsdale, MN for medical care after falling several stories into a hole intended for a basement.
